One of the most crucial elements in ensuring a bird's health is its diet. Parrots should be fed a high-quality, high-quality pellet or diet that is formulated to meet the requirements of these birds. It should be supplemented with fresh fruits and vegetables, as well as some grains. Diet should be regulated to avoid obesity which can cause serious health issues for pet parrots.
In the wild, African greys are omnivorous and eat a variety of vegetables, fruits nuts, seeds, and even nuts. However, in captivity seeds shouldn't be the primary source of food because they may be deficient in vitamins and minerals. Pellets, however, are a better option as they supply the essential nutrients. It is also important to make sure that a parrot has access to a clean supply of water.

Training
The key to successfully training the Baby African Grey Parrot (Https://Git.Fuwafuwa.Moe) for sale is to treat the bird with respect and make the process fun. It is crucial that the bird is able to feel you are a friend and not a tool to do tricks or eat. It is also important to avoid methods like coercion or punishment since they will break your relationship. Instead, concentrate on positive reinforcement and training that is based on rewards.
These birds are extremely intelligent and require lots of interaction with their owners to keep them entertained and occupied. It is possible to train them to speak. However, it is a lengthy process and is usually not initiated until the bird reaches around one year of age. The best method of training your African Grey Parrot is to spend several hours each day playing with it and handling it in a supervised, parrot-proof area.
During these sessions, the pet is taught how to communicate with people, and that positive reinforcement can help it to get what it desires. This will reduce the development of behavioral issues, like biting and screaming. In these training sessions it is important to praise your pet and give it lots of treats.
A baby parrot will often begin by trying to bite you. If this happens, you'll need to stop the training and retrain your pet to accept your hand. If the parrot continues to screaming and threatening to bite you, it might be necessary to engage a professional trainer.
Once the parrot is comfortable accepting your hand, you can start to do target training. This is done by holding an item close to the bird and slowly moving it towards your body. When the bird stops thrashing or is no longer threatening to bite, you can put your hand on its head and scratch it gently.
Start with target training inside the cage. This will teach your pet to touch your hand, without being afraid of being bitten. Once you've achieved this, you are able to begin training outside of the cage. These sessions should be frequent and brief to ensure that your pet does not lose interest or become bored with your training.

One of the most frequent issues with timneh african grey parrot Greys is their tendency to chew and destroy anything in their enclosures. You can limit this by making sure their cages are large and by with a variety of materials for toys. Egg cartons can be turned into foraging toys, by putting treats inside them and wrapping them in cardboard or paper. You can also use paper cups and skewers to make food-dispensing toys for your pet. You can also enhance your pet's space by adding nontoxic plants and hammocks.
